What is the Czech Republic capital flows

Capital flows in the Czech Republic refer to the movement of money into and out of the country for the purpose of investment, trade, or other financial activities. These flows can be both domestic, involving transactions within the country, and international, involving transactions with foreign entities. The Czech Republic has been experiencing significant capital inflows in recent years, driven by foreign direct investment, portfolio investment, and trade. These capital flows play a crucial role in the country's economic development, as they provide funding for businesses, stimulate growth, and contribute to overall stability in the financial markets. However, managing these flows effectively is important to ensure they do not lead to imbalances or excessive volatility in the economy.
